降水时空分布不均匀性的信息熵分析——(Ⅱ)模型评价与应用

Information Entropy Analysis on Nonuniformity of Precipitation Dis tribution in Time-Space, Ⅱ, Model Evaluat ion and Application

  • 摘要: 在数值模拟的基础上提出了信息传输函数模型,使信息传输研究从离散状态过渡到连续状态.引进了信息距离与信息场的概念,将站点的信息传输从单一方向推广到周围区域,最后利用聚类分析法进一步刻划了降雨的空间分布不均匀性.

     

    Abstract: The Information transfer function model is set up on the base of numerical simulation,so that the information transfer study is transisted from dispersed states to continuous.The information distance and the information field are defined,and the information transfer is extended from only one direction to an area.Finally the nonuniformity on precipitation distribution is studied further using the clustering method.
